Englewood Customs
Closed
Photos
3069 S McCall Rd
Englewood, FL 34224
Englewood Customs is a local business in Englewood, FL, specializing in custom automotive services.
With a focus on customization and personalization, they offer a range of services to enhance vehicles according to individual preferences.
Generated from their business information
Also at this address
See a problem?